Trimble and Ferris back for Ulster

Ireland duo Andrew Trimble and Stephen Ferris have been included in Ulster’s 28 man squad to face Ospreys in the RaboDirect PRO12 on Saturday (Liberty Stadium, 6.30pm).

Trimble was part of the international squad that toured New Zealand in June, while Ferris hasn’t played since the Heineken Cup final defeat in May.

Rory Best and Chris Henry are still unavailable because of the IRFU’s player management scheme but are expected to make a return in the coming weeks.
